Super-Typhoon Yolanda – My First Three Days
On Nov 8, 2013, super typhoon Yolanda (Haiyan) hit the town of Tacloban in the Philippines. I was in Tacloban at the time, and my hotel was hit with a storm surge ten feet deep. This is the first part of the journal I kept through the experience.
